Panada Population - Ganjam, Orissa

Panada is a medium size village located in GOLANTHARA Block of Ganjam district, Orissa with total 78 families residing. The Panada village has population of 448 of which 217 are males while 231 are females as per Population Census 2011.

In Panada village population of children with age 0-6 is 77 which makes up 17.19 % of total population of village. Average Sex Ratio of Panada village is 1065 which is higher than Orissa state average of 979. Child Sex Ratio for the Panada as per census is 1484, higher than Orissa average of 941.

Panada village has lower literacy rate compared to Orissa. In 2011, literacy rate of Panada village was 51.75 % compared to 72.87 % of Orissa. In Panada Male literacy stands at 60.22 % while female literacy rate was 43.24 %.

Caste Factor

In Panada village, most of the villagers are from Schedule Caste (SC). Schedule Caste (SC) constitutes 59.38 % while Schedule Tribe (ST) were 3.57 % of total population in Panada village.

Work Profile

In Panada village out of total population, 280 were engaged in work activities. 35.00 % of workers describe their work as Main Work (Employment or Earning more than 6 Months) while 65.00 % were involved in Marginal activity providing livelihood for less than 6 months. Of 280 workers engaged in Main Work, 3 were cultivators (owner or co-owner) while 95 were Agricultural labourer.
